For all $N \\in \\mathbb{N}^{\\ast}$ prime to $p$, let $k_{N}$ be a finite field of characteristic $p$ containing a primitive $N$-th root of unity. Let $X_{k_{N},N}=\\text{ }\\mathbb{P}^{1} - (\\{0,\\infty\\} \\cup \\mu_{N})\\text{ }/\\text{ }k_{N}$. This work is an explicit theory of the crystalline pro-unipotent fundamental groupoid $(\\pi_{1}^{\\un,\\crys})$ of $X_{k_{N},N}$. In the parts I to IV, we have considered each possible value of $N$ separately.
